Windows Virtual Machine


Virtualization makes use of software to simulate the hardware of the computer to create a virtual system. Windows virtual machines can consolidate servers. Before the advent of virtualization, several datacenters were filled with servers running different applications and operating systems. With virtualization, multiple applications and operating systems can be stored at a sole server.


Operating a virtual machine is an efficient manner to use an operating system without the need to install it on your personal computer. Virtual machines require separate operating system installation on a single computer, wherein, each operating system has a share of the resources of the computer system. For instance, you can install Linux virtual machine on your Windows PC. Numerous operating system installations can exist simultaneously on the same physical machine or device at the same time. The coexistence pertains as long as the device is capable of the hardware. Thus, virtual machines are a friendly means of extending your server and desktop environments.


Also, the windows virtual machines feature high availability and can be maintained and provisioned easily.

Virtualization is the main component of computing. Several organizations deploy servers that function or run at a small segment of their potential. It happens mostly because they dedicate their physical server to a particular application. This is an inefficient mechanism as the excess potential or capacity of the servers is not being utilized. This, furthermore, leads to increased IT costs, and costs of operation.


In order to drive increased utilization of the capacity and reduce costs, virtualization was introduced. Virtualization helps you slash or reduce your IT expenditure while reducing downtime and enhancing resiliency in critical situations such as disaster recovery. It increases productivity and efficiency of the organization while controlling DevOps and independence.

Perks that Virtual machine can offer you


Increased productivity


The IT developers become increasingly productive as they need to maintain and command only the host machines or systems. For traditional data centers that haven’t advanced to the virtualized environment, hardware maintenance and time-consuming and tedious.

Easy provisioning


It might take days and hours to replace a physical server that is hit by a disastrous event. On the other hand, Windows virtual machines take only a few moments to become up and running as they can be cloned or replicated.

Saves costs


Before the advent of virtual machines, enterprises used to spend a significant amount on IT to acquire physical servers to host applications. However, with the development of the virtual environment, enterprises took the turn to buy robust hardware that can comprise virtual systems. Of course, it is cheaper than buying increased hardware. Also, the life of outdated or old software can be extended with virtual machines.


Efficient DevOps


The maintenance operations are not much impacted by the production environment. In several cases, performance maintenance does not lead to downtime. Also, windows virtual machines allow simplified development and testing processes for websites and applications.

Environment-friendly operations


As the number of servers is reduced, the power consumption also decreases proportionally. Thus, the operating expenses are lowered and the carbon footprint from your data centers is also reduced.

Embedded security management


Security management in virtual machines denotes security solutions that use software and are fabricated to function within a virtualized environment. Virtualized security is dynamic and flexible. It is not linked to a device, instead deployed in the network (which is usually cloud-based). The security functions and services move around dynamically built workloads. The security management of virtual machines helps in security multi-cloud and hybrid environments.



Reduce workloads with virtual machines


Organizations deploy virtual machines in their data centers to look after a wide range of workloads and cases. Virtual machines help enterprises consolidate servers and enhance the utilization of hardware resources. As multiple virtual machines can run simultaneously on a single server, enterprises can use resources on the sole server more efficiently. Thus, the requirement to spread workloads on multiple servers is reduced. In this manner, the operating expenses and capital is saved.


Moreover, virtual machines promote isolated environments which make it possible to function different types of applications and operating systems on a single server. The organizations can deploy business applications and legacy in the environment they need without having to look after contention problems or the need for buying multiple servers to support distinct environments.
